Stanley Consultants, Inc. is an American-based international engineering, construction, and environmental engineering services company with its headquarters in Muscatine, Iowa, U.S.A.. Stanley also has offices in 17 other locations in the U.S. and 10 countries. The company has undertaken projects in over 96 countries.

Stanley Consultants began as a small engineering firm in Muscatine, Iowa founded by Charles Young in 1913. In 1932, C. Maxwell "Max" Stanley joined the firm, and its business and geographical reach grew. The 1930's brought an expansion of public works projects in the United States under the federal Public Works Administration. And Stanley's firm obtained many government contracts dealing with rural electrification, state roads and highways, and water supply and sanitation systems.

In 1957, Stanley Consultants began its international operations, opening an office in Monrovia, Liberia. In the 1960's, Stanley Consultants expanded its services to meet client needs that exceeded pure engineering. The company developed a multi-disciplinary consulting services practice that now includes professional architects, economists, construction managers, and planners - among others. The company continues to expand its business, and recently entered into the environmental engineering and design-build fields.
